Responsibilities

  • Develop and maintain software for robotic systems, embedded interfaces, control applications, test systems, production support tools, and operator-facing tools.
  • Support software development from concept through implementation, simulation, hardware bring-up, integration, testing, deployment, troubleshooting, and production support.
  • Integrate software with motors, actuators, encoders, sensors, motion controllers, embedded systems, machine vision systems, industrial networks, and robotic equipment.
  • Partner with mechanical, electrical, controls, systems, manufacturing, test, and quality teams to define requirements, interfaces, verification approaches, and release criteria.
  • Troubleshoot issues across software, controls, electrical hardware, sensors, actuators, networks, robotic hardware, and production equipment.
  • Support code reviews, version control, automated testing, release practices, documentation, and production support practices.
  • Communicate software status, technical risks, trade studies, test results, and implementation plans to technical and cross-functional stakeholders.

Requirements

  • Degree in Software Engineering, Computer Science, Electrical Engineering, Robotics, Mechatronics, or Aerospace Engineering, or equivalent experience.
  • 2–5 years of professional software engineering experience involving robotics, motion control, embedded systems, hardware systems, or other complex technical products.
  • Strong proficiency in C++ and/or Python.
  • Experience with robotics frameworks such as ROS or ROS 2, including real-time variants or real-time robotics applications.
  • Hands-on experience integrating software with motors, actuators, encoders, sensors, motion controllers, embedded systems, machine vision, or industrial networks.
  • Experience with real-time or embedded software, control loops, deterministic timing, and hardware bring-up.
  • Knowledge of software architecture, Git-based workflows, code reviews, automated testing, release practices, documentation, and production support.
  • Experience developing in Linux environments.
  • Ability to define requirements, evaluate alternatives, align stakeholders, and deliver software in a cross-functional hardware development environment.
  • Preferred experience includes motion planning, kinematics and dynamics, trajectory generation, controls software, robot calibration, perception systems, state estimation, and sensor fusion.
  • Preferred experience includes real-time operating systems, bare-metal embedded development, hard real-time control, safety-critical software, aerospace or industrial communication interfaces, simulation, digital twins, hardware-in-the-loop, software-in-the-loop, automated test equipment, and production test systems.
  • Preferred experience includes fault tolerance, redundancy, cybersecurity, configuration control, harsh-environment systems, and aerospace, defense, space, advanced manufacturing, industrial robotics, or medical-device environments.
